Key Responsibilities
- Establishes the reporting criteria, content and format for monthly status reports, cost variance reporting, forecasts, budget updates, change control notices, and monthly presentations to Owner management.
- Provides regular weekly and monthly reports with appropriate analysis to internal and external stakeholders.
- Develops execution plans and establishes logic networks for sequencing of tasks related to engineering, procurement, fabrication, and construction activities.
- Supports the development of schedules for projects and studies.
- Analyzes contractor schedules and prepares critical path task reports.
- Maintains oversight of contractor performance against established schedule targets.
- Coordinates weekly schedule review meetings with necessary stakeholders to assess and plan work on a 6-week rolling forecast.
- Alerts project management and engineering personnel to potential schedule risks and supports the development of recovery plans.
- Follows up on action items with responsible personnel to ensure that items are closed out completely and on time.
- Develops and maintains equipment lists throughout the project lifecycle.
- Participates in the overall procurement process, including scope definition, specification preparation, datasheet population, tender evaluation and recommendation, contract award, kick-off meetings, and expediting both internal and external parties to meet schedule requirements.
- Follows up with vendor representatives to verify that all technical documentation required for fabrication and shipment is submitted and reviewed in accordance with the project schedule.
- Attends and participates in design and project execution review meetings.
- Prepares various project deliverables such as Scopes of Work, Technical Specifications, reports, engineering calculations, estimates, and financial models.
- Prepares minutes of meeting for various project meetings and follows up on action items with responsible personnel to ensure that items are closed out completely and on time.
